Stephen J Chan 1899 - 1988

Stephen J Chan of Walnut Grove, Sacramento County, CA was born on June 19, 1899 in China or Mongolia or Sinkian or Tibet, and died at age 88 years old on February 17, 1988.

In 1899, in the year that Stephen J Chan was born, on February 4th, the Philippine–American War began. The Philippines objected to the Treaty of Paris, signed in 1898, that transferred possession of the Philippines from Spain to the U.S. Filipinos began a fight for independence and fighting between U.S. forces and those of the Philippine Republic broke out. On June 2nd, the Philippines officially declared war on the United States.
